Wallyson

Ricardo Maciel Monteiro Wallyson called Wallyson, ( born October 17, 1988 in Macaíba, RN ) is a Brazilian footballer.

Cruzeiro EC

On July 29, 2010, the player was presented as a gain. The football director Dimas Fonseca presented here in detail the workings of investors, which have made possible the setting. The player signed a two -year contract and the club was involved in 30 percent of the economic rights in future negotiations. He made his debut on August 22. On 15 September, he scored his first goal for the team in the 4-2 victory over Guarani FC.

In early 2011 secured Wallyson quickly his place in the starting XI. Also in the Copa Libertadores 2011, he scored two goals in the first two games and quickly the lead in the scoring charts. Although the club already retired from in the second round. Wallyson was at the end of the tournament, alongside Roberto Nanni of Club Cerro Porteño 's top scorer with seven goals.

7 August 2011 Wallyson suffered a broken ankle during the match between Cruzeiro and Internacional. He had to undergo a two-hour operation at the moment. After a long process of recovery and rehabilitation, the striker returned in an official match in 2012, against the Guarani -MG.
